DMV and a Zip Code Change
By Gary Becker
Gary is also featured in "A Beach Bums View" in the Barrier Islands Gazette.

They are possibly going to assign a new zip code to the small town I call home. Now I really didn't care if my zip code was changed or not until I began to think about all the things that I deal with that require a zip code. Florida Drivers License

One of those things that I am going to have to deal with is changing the address on my driver's license. I decided to call the fine folks at the driver's license place and ask how I go about changing the zip code on my drivers license. The call went like this:

"Driver's License Bureau can you hold?" Before I could answer I heard a click followed by the mellow sounds of the most obnoxious music I have ever heard. After about 10 minutes a voice that reminded me of the "Wicked Witch from the West" blurted out "Can I help you?"

"Yes, my community is changing it's zip code and I would like to know what I need to do to change the zip code on my driver's license?" I asked."You need to fill out a change of address form and obtain a new driver's license." said the voice.

"But I'm not changing my address, I'm only changing my zip code" I told her.

"Our computers will not accept a zip code change. They will only accept a total change of address." the voice advised.

"So I have to fill out a change of address form with my current address and the new zip code?" I questioned.

"No. Our computers will not accept a zip code only change. You must completely change your address. In other words, you have to move to another residence." the voice stated.

"But I don't want to move. I only want to change my zip code. No that's wrong. I don't want to change my zip code, someone else does." I pleaded.

"Sir, if your zip code has been changed, your driver's license must reflect that change or you will be in violation of the law and subject to a civil penalty. In order to maintain a valid driver's license, you must move to a new residence and submit a change of address form. You may then, after 10 days, move back to your old address and resubmit the old address as a new address reflecting the new zip code. This is the only way you can change the zip code on your driver's license", said the voice as it grew more and more impatient.

"Are you telling me I must move out of my home and into another residence, get a new driver's license with the new address on it, then move back into my original residence and get yet another new driver's license just to change my zip code?", I said in dismay.

"Yes, have a nice day" click.

I suddenly got a real bad feeling about this zip code thing.
